A new chapter in the Paper Mario series
Paper Mario: The Origami King brings a fresh, quirky adventure to the Nintendo Switch, continuing the beloved franchise’s mix of paper-thin aesthetics and engaging storytelling. This title introduces players to a unique world of origami-inspired environments and characters. Mario’s quest to rescue Princess Peach from the mysterious, paper-folding villain King Olly takes players across beautifully designed, paper-crafted landscapes, offering both puzzle-solving and exploration. The game’s distinctive art style blends seamlessly with its dynamic combat mechanics, providing an experience that’s visually stunning and full of charm.
Combat with a twist
One of the standout features of The Origami King is its innovative combat system. Unlike previous Paper Mario games, the turn-based battles are centred around a puzzle mechanic where players must arrange enemies in a circular grid for maximum damage. This requires strategic thinking, timing, and creativity to unlock the full potential of each attack. While it’s not your traditional RPG battle system, this fresh approach makes combat both exciting and thought-provoking, rewarding players who enjoy problem-solving alongside their usual action.
A story with heart
Beyond its mechanics, Paper Mario: The Origami King tells a heartfelt and engaging story filled with humour, emotion, and memorable characters. The game’s writing shines with quirky dialogue and a sense of playfulness that never feels forced. Each chapter introduces a new set of challenges and characters, while Mario’s bond with his companions, particularly the loyal Olivia, adds emotional depth to the adventure. It’s a journey that both old fans and newcomers can enjoy, offering a delightful blend of humour, adventure, and heartwarming moments throughout.
